在Java Web开发中,JSP(JavaServer Pages)技术扮演着至关重要的角色。它允许我们构建动态的网页,实现与用户的交互。在实际开发过程中,我们经常会遇到JSP缓存的问题。本文将深入探讨load加载清空JSP缓存实例的方法,帮助大家更好地解决这一问题。

1. JSP缓存的概念

我们先来了解一下JSP缓存的概念。JSP缓存是指将JSP页面的输出结果暂时存储在服务器上,当有相同的请求时,可以直接从缓存中获取结果,从而提高页面的访问速度。在某些情况下,缓存可能会导致数据不一致的问题,这时就需要我们手动清除缓存。

load加载清空jsp缓存实例_详细load加载清空JSP缓存实例的奥秘  第1张

2. load加载清空JSP缓存实例的原理

load加载清空JSP缓存实例,主要是通过修改JSP页面的URL来实现的。具体来说,我们可以通过在URL中添加特定的参数,来告知服务器需要重新加载该页面,从而清除缓存。

以下是一个简单的示例:

```html

http://www.example.com/index.jsp

http://www.example.com/index.jsp?_t=123456789

```

在这个示例中,`_t` 参数用于标识当前请求,当服务器收到带有 `_t` 参数的请求时,会认为这是一个新的请求,从而重新加载JSP页面,清除缓存。

3. load加载清空JSP缓存实例的方法

3.1 在JSP页面中添加自定义参数

在JSP页面中,我们可以通过添加自定义参数的方式来实现load加载清空缓存的功能。以下是一个示例:

```jsp

<%@ page contentType="